Reading Computer Lab
The Reading Computer Lab is an essential component of our department as well as an important element of the College's overall network of support services. Students use the lab for assistance with their reading and study skills issues. The lab contains a variety of programs and materials on many reading levels. Complete classes and individual students have access to the lab. Tutors are available for class and individual assistance.
Tutoring
Tutorial support is available throughout the year in the computer lab (Colston Hall 404), the Center for Education and Literary Arts (Colston Hall 407), and in the classroom. An education major is available in the Center for Education and Literary Arts to provide assistance in reading and study skills. A CUNY graduate writing fellow is available to all education majors throughout the semester.
